U.S. takes 5½-2½ lead, its biggest on opening day since 1979

Associated Press

Saturday, September 20, 2008

LOUISVILLE, Ky. -- Phil Mickelson pointed his putter toward the cup, took a step and punched his fist to celebrate a clutch birdie. Boo Weekley revved up the crowd after holing a 50-foot putt from just off the green. Anthony Kim set a record for high-fives. Yes, those were the Americans having all the fun Friday at Valhalla. At the Ryder Cup, no less. "My cheeks are sore from smiling all day long," Justin Leonard said. "This was a lot different than my other Ryder Cup experiences." In ...
